Elora Gorge Conservation
offers the perfect mix of dramatic natural beauty and romantic adventure, with its towering limestone cliffs, rushing river, forested trails, and scenic lookouts over the gorge, making it a stunning location for bold, timeless engagement photos. Things to know: parking/entry fees apply, weekday only, hiking required

Rockwood Conservation
offers the perfect mix of nature and romance, with its scenic trails, towering limestone cliffs, quiet forests, and waterfront views, making it a dreamy location for adventurous, timeless engagement photos.
Things to know: weekday only, entrance fee, dogs welcomed on leash, hiking

Scottsdale Farm - Georgetown
offers the perfect mix of rustic charm and natural beauty, with its rolling meadows, historic stone buildings, open fields, and peaceful forest trails, making it a dreamy location for romantic, timeless engagement photos. Things to know: free access, parking available, seasonal conditions can affect trails, weekday only . dog friendly
Burlington Beach
offers the perfect blend of shoreline beauty and relaxed coastal charm, with its sandy stretches, calm waterfront views, and glowing sunsets over Lake Ontario, making it an ideal location for romantic, carefree engagement photos. Things to know: free access, parking available nearby, weekday only , best at golden hour. dogs welcomed
Guelph Arboretum
offers the perfect mix of curated gardens and peaceful natural beauty, with its forested trails, open meadows, seasonal blooms, and quiet pathways, making it a timeless location for romantic, nature-inspired engagement photos. Things to know: free access, parking available, beautiful year-round with changing seasonal scenery, can be busy during peak bloom seasons.
Yorklands Greenhub (Guelph)
offers the perfect blend of natural landscapes and quiet, historic character, with its open green spaces, trails, lakes, and unique industrial-meets-nature backdrop, making it a versatile location for romantic, earthy engagement photos. Things to know: free access, limited parking, very quiet weekday location, best all year around! dog friendly

The Beaches of Ontario!
Port Stanley, Long Point & Pinery Provincial Park
offer the perfect stretch of Ontario beach beauty, with soft sandy shores, rolling dunes, calm lake waters, and breathtaking golden sunsets over Lake Erie and Lake Huron, making them ideal locations for romantic, carefree engagement photos. Things to know: parking/park entry fees may apply, beaches can be busy in summer, best at sunrise or sunset for softer light, wind is common along open shorelines, dog friendly in some areas.
Snyder Flats Conservation Area (kitchener)
offers the perfect mix of wide open nature and peaceful riverside views, with its tall grasses, winding trails, wooded areas, and scenic lookout points over, making it a dreamy location for romantic, light and airy engagement photos. Things to know: free access, dog friendly, best at sunrise or golden hour.
Wilson Flats (elora)
offers the perfect mix of quiet riverside scenery and untouched natural beauty, with its open trails, wooded areas, flowing water, and peaceful atmosphere, making it a lovely location for relaxed, intimate engagement photos. Things to know: free access, limited parking nearby, trails can be muddy after rain, best enjoyed during golden hour or early evenings
Guelph Lake conservation
offers the perfect mix of waterfront beauty and open natural scenery, with its sandy beach areas, calm lake views, wooded trails, and glowing sunset light, making it a versatile location for romantic, carefree engagement photos. Things to know: conservation area entry fee applies, parking available, can be busy during summer weekends, best at golden hour for softer light and fewer crowds.
